Family reunions are a beautiful tapestry of generations coming together, filled with shared meals, long conversations, and the joyful noise of cousins playing. Amid the bustling schedule of barbecues and group photos, finding a quiet moment to connect across age gaps can sometimes be a challenge. Picture books offer the perfect bridge, serving as a gentle anchor that brings toddlers, teenagers, and grandparents into the same circle. Reading aloud creates a shared experience, sparking memories for the elders and building new ones for the children. The core of any family reunion is the connection between the oldest and youngest members. Books that mirror these relationships validate the magic of grandparenthood and the wonder of childhood curiosity. Look for narratives that explore the unique language of love shared between grandchildren and grandparents, which often transcends words. Stories about learning a traditional craft, cooking a secret family recipe, or simply taking a slow walk through nature capture the exact essence of what makes reunions so impactful. When read aloud in a large group, these books encourage older relatives to share their own childhood anecdotes, transforming a simple reading session into an interactive oral history lesson. Not all reading sessions need to be quiet and reflective. When the afternoon heat keeps everyone indoors, or when the energy levels of the children start to peak, turn to highly interactive picture books. Choose stories with rhythmic, repetitive refrains that the entire audience can chant together. Books that encourage movement, animal sound imitations, or seeking hidden details in the illustrations keep wiggly toddlers engaged while drawing chuckles from the adults. This shared laughter breaks the ice, especially for extended family members who see each other only once every few years. Incorporating picture books into your event itinerary can quickly become a beloved tradition for future gatherings. Consider dedicating a specific time each day for the family story hour, perhaps right after lunch when the sun is at its peak or just before bedtime as the evening winds down. To make the experience even more memorable, invite a different relative to read each day, allowing aunties, uncles, and grandparents to bring their unique storytelling flair to the circle. You can also set up a designated reading blanket under a shady tree, creating an inviting space where family members can drift in and out as they please.
